| Statmatic is a Laravel and Git powered content management system (CMS). Prior to versions 5.73.16 and 6.7.2, an authenticated control panel user with access to Antlers-enabled inputs may be able to achieve remote code execution in the application context. That can lead to full compromise of the application, including access to sensitive configuration, modification or exfiltration of data, and potential impact on availability. Exploitation is only possible where Antlers runs on user-controlled content—for example, content fields with Antlers explicitly enabled (requiring permission to configure fields and to edit entries), built-in config that supports Antlers such as Forms email notification settings (requiring configuration permission), or third-party addons that add Antlers-enabled fields to entries (for example, the SEO Pro addon). In each case the attacker must have the relevant control panel permissions. This has been fixed in 5.73.16 and 6.7.2. Users of addons that depend on Statamic should ensure that after updating they are running a patched Statamic version. |

| pdf-image (npm package) through version 2.0.0 allows OS command injection via the pdfFilePath parameter. The constructGetInfoCommand and constructConvertCommandForPage functions use util.format() to interpolate user-controlled file paths into shell command strings that are executed via child_process.exec() |
| textract through 2.5.0 is vulnerable to OS Command Injection via the file path parameter in multiple extractors. When processing files with malicious filenames, the filePath is passed directly to child_process.exec() in lib/extractors/doc.js, rtf.js, dxf.js, images.js, and lib/util.js with inadequate sanitization |
| node-tesseract-ocr is an npm package that provides a Node.js wrapper for Tesseract OCR. In all versions through 2.2.1, the recognize() function in src/index.js is vulnerable to OS Command Injection. The file path parameter is concatenated into a shell command string and passed to child_process.exec() without proper sanitization |
| thumbler through 1.1.2 allows OS command injection via the input, output, time, or size parameter in the thumbnail() function because user input is concatenated into a shell command string passed to child_process.exec() without proper sanitization or escaping. |
| Multiple Stored XSS vulnerabilities exist in Seafile Server version 13.0.15,13.0.16-pro,12.0.14 and prior and fixed in 13.0.17, 13.0.17-pro, and 12.0.20-pro, via the Seadoc (sdoc) editor. The application fails to properly sanitize WebSocket messages regarding document structure updates. This allows authenticated remote attackers to inject malicious JavaScript payloads via the src attribute of embedded Excalidraw whiteboards or the href attribute of anchor tags |
